On Saturday, the 21st of November, our kitchen appliances were delivered from Best Buy. After extensive research, we choose Whirlpool for their low failure rate; eco-friendly construction; and the fact that they’re made in the USA! They look awesome next to the cabinets! I’ll get in-place pictures added soon!

Electric Range – WFE371LVS

This range has some great features like a hidden bake element. That means no smoke alarm testing for food running over! Plus, it has a steam cleaning feature for the oven.

Refrigerator – ED5FVGXWS

We ended up choosing this refrigerator for several reasons: the gallon door bins, electronic ice/water controls, inline water filtration, and the large wire freezer shelves.

Microwave #1 – WMH1162XVS

This particular microwave is mounted over the range. Oh, and I did say microwave #1 – we have two. Why? It’s great for candy making, chocolate tempering, etc.

Microwave #2 – MT4155SPS

This is a higher power microwave than the over-the-range model. This will definitely come in handy!

Dishwasher – DU1055XTVS

Dare I say this will be my favorite appliance? Some of the features we like include – silverware basket can be placed anywhere, sanitary rinse, and integrated food grinder.

John’s at the house today with the carpet installers! We had a brief conversation a moment ago. They arrived at 9:30AM this morning and we’re starting to lay down the carpet. They had get the pad and tack strips down first.

We chose a line of carpet called Bliss by Beaulieu. It’s designed for a healthy home – that means little or no off-gassing; made from environmentally-friendly materials; and contains silver and zinc to inhibit microbial growth. We purchased it from Lowes as it was made for them by Beaulieu. The color is called “Tranquility.” I’ll upload pictures soon!

Drywall

The taping and mudding began yesterday. All the windows in the house were left open overnight to help with the drying process. The team anticipates finishing either Friday or Saturday.

Flooring

We’ve chosen Congoleum’s AirStep Plus for the entryway from the garage up to the kitchen. This includes the 1/2 bathroom, laundry room, and utility closet. The Satin Cloud pattern is what we selected. For the other bathrooms, we’re leaning towards ceramic tile similar to the sample shown below.

tileSample

The foyer, great room, dining room and office will be laminated flooring. The bedrooms, stairs and upstairs hallway will be carpeted. (More on all of that later!)
